extends與implements的區別


extends與implements的區別:
 
1、extends 是繼承父類,只要那個類不是聲明為final或者那個類定義為abstract的就能繼承,JAVA中不支持多重繼承,但是可以用接口來實現,這樣就用到了implements,繼承只能繼承一個類,但implements可以實現多個接口,用逗號分開就行了。
 
2、繼承過后通常會定義一些父類沒有的成員或者方法。
 
3、子類B對象的實例,不僅能夠訪問自己的屬性和方法,也能夠訪問父類的屬性和方法


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M